Middle-income households those with an income that is two-thirds to double the U.S. median household income had incomes ranging from about $48,500 to $145,500 in 2018. As the EPI reports: "The bottom 90% earned 69.8% of all earnings in 1979 but only 60.2% in 2020. And Federal Reserve data shows that as of 2021, the top 1% of earners now hold 27% of the nation's wealth, a larger share than the 26.8% held by the middle 60% of U.S. households (often used to define the middle class by economists). Lower-income households have incomes lower than two-thirds of the median, and upper-income households have incomes that are more than double the median. About half of U.S. adults (52%) lived in middle-income households in 2018, according to a new Pew Research Center analysis of government data. $173,176. Our latest analysis shows that the share of adults who live in middle-income households varies widely across the 260 metropolitan areas examined, from 39% in Las Cruces, New Mexico, to 67% in Ogden-Clearfield, Utah.
